Conference Producers

The Challenge:

You plan and execute cutting-edge educational and networking events for the biotech and pharmaceutical communities from beginning to end.  This includes conducting preliminary research, inviting internationally renowned speakers, and writing scientific/technical copy in layman’s terms for printed programs/agenda/CD’s.  Also design event brochures/ads/banners/CDs and conduct marketing campaigns in conjunction with the Marketing team. Mingle with the speakers and attendees, liaison between vendors, and work with Hotels/Conference Centers. Positions available at different levels.

What we’re looking for:

We need someone who is self-motivated and has the ability to travel (20%) and manage all aspects of the events production to ensure goals are met on time.  You will have a quick grasp of the biotech and pharmaceutical industry as well as a strong research and analysis background.

Executive Conference Producer

The Executive Conference Producer oversees research, development and production of cutting-edge educational and networking events for biotech and pharmaceutical community. Working closely with a team of, internal and external Marketing, Exhibits/Sponsorship, Logistics, Customer Service, Public Relations and Contracts experts, the Executive Producer will be responsible for creating and implementing successful meetings for assigned segments and audiences. The Executive Producer creates the agenda, invites high level speakers, writes program copy, works with team members such as Marketing on the design of the event brochures and marketing campaigns, Exhibits and Sponsorship Sales to put together and implement an effective strategy, Logistics to implement a successful event, etc. The Executive Producer manages all aspects of the event(s) to insure that goals are met.

Candidate Qualification:

The ideal candidate will have a Bachelor's degree and a minimum of 5 years experience in conference production with extensive understanding of the biotech and pharmaceutical industry.  They have the ability to harness the talents of their team effectively, manage multiple complex projects simultaneously, work under constant pressure and meet deadlines.  This person will demonstrate a strong research/analysis capability, include a knack for business trends and issues, and  possess an entrepreneurial and creative drive. Excellent communication, organizational, interpersonal and leadership skills are required.
